This is just a quick request for you to stop adding non-notable entries to the list of notable alumni at North Shore Senior High School (Texas). Notability on Wikipedia has specific definitions, none of which the subject seems to meet. Most notable American football players already have their own Wikipedia articles; for those who don't, the most common way that they meet the notability criteria is playing in a regular season game for an NFL team. Welcome to Wikipedia. I saw that you edited or created Matt Conerly, and I noticed that your username, "Gmconerly", may not comply with our username policy. Please note that you may not use a username that represents the name of a company, group, organization, product, or website. Examples of usernames that are not allowed include "XYZ Company", "MyWidgetsUSA.com", and "Trammel Museum of Art". However, you are invited to use a username that contains such a name if it identifies you personally, such as "Mark at WidgetsUSA", "Jack Smith at the XY Foundation", and "WidgetFan87".

Please also note that Wikipedia does not allow accounts to be shared by multiple people, and that you may not advocate for or promote any company, group, organization, product, or website, regardless of your username.
